摘要:代码如下:<html> <title> </title> <script src="js/jquery.min.js" type="text/javascript"></script> <script language="javascript" type="text/javascript"> $(document).ready(function(){ $("ul.menu li:first-child").addClass("current"); $("p.content").find("p.layout:not(:first-child)").hide(); $("p.content p.layout").attr("id", function(){return idNumber("No")+ $("p.content p.layout").index(this)}); $("ul.menu li").click(function(){ var c = $("ul.menu li"); var index = c.index(this); var p = idNumber("No"); show(c,index,p); }); function show(controlMenu,num,prefix){ var content= prefix + num; $('#'+content).siblings().hide(); $('#'+content).show(); controlMenu.eq(num).addClass("current").siblings().removeClass("current"); }; function idNumber(prefix){ var idNum = prefix; return idNum; }; }); </script> <style type="text/css"> * {margin:0; padding:0} ul,li { list-style:none } .box { border:1px solid #ccc; margin:10px; } .tagMenu { height: 24px; position:relative; border-bottom:1px solid #999 } .tagMenu ul { position:absolute; bottom:-1px; height:26px; } ul.menu li { float:left; border-left:1px solid #999; padding:0 12px; cursor:pointer } ul.menu li.current { border:1px solid #999; border-bottom:none; background:#fff; height:25px; line-height:26px; margin:0 } .content { padding:10px} </style> <body> <p class="box"> <p class="tagMenu"> <ul class="menu"> <li>Label 1.1</li> <li>Label 1.2</li> <li>Label 1.3</li> <li>Label 1.4</li> </ul> </p> <p class="content"> <p class="layout">infomation 1.1</p> <p class="layout">infomation 1.2</p> <p class="layout">infomation 1.3</p> <p class="layout">infomation 1.4</p> </p> </p> </body> </html>

脚本宝典收集整理的这篇文章主要介绍了

js实例教程-基于jquery库的tab新形式使用方法

脚本宝典小编觉得挺不错的,现在分享给大家,也给大家做个参考,希望能帮助你少写一行代码,多一份安全和惬意。

小宝典致力于为广大程序猿(媛)提供高品质的代码服务,请大家多多光顾小站,小宝典在此谢过。

代码如下:

<html>
<title>
</title>
<script src="js/jquery.min.js" type="text/javascript"></script>
<script language="javascript" type="text/javascript">
$(document).ready(function(){
$("ul.menu li:first-child").addClass("current");
$("p.content").find("p.layout:not(:first-child)").hide();
$("p.content p.layout").attr("id", function(){return idNumber("No")+ $("p.content p.layout").index(this)});
$("ul.menu li").click(function(){
var c = $("ul.menu li");
var index = c.index(this);
var p = idNumber("No");
show(c,index,p);
});

function show(controlMenu,num,prefix){
var content= prefix + num;
$('#'+content).siblings().hide();
$('#'+content).show();
controlMenu.eq(num).addClass("current").siblings().removeClass("current");
};

function idNumber(prefix){
var idNum = prefix;
return idNum;
};
});
</script>
<style type="text/css">
* {margin:0; padding:0}
ul,li {
list-style:none
}
.box {
border:1px solid #ccc;
margin:10px;
}
.tagMenu {
height: 24px;
position:relative;
border-bottom:1px solid #999
}
.tagMenu ul {
position:absolute;
bottom:-1px;
height:26px;
}
ul.menu li {
float:left;
border-left:1px solid #999;
padding:0 12px;
cursor:pointer
}
ul.menu li.current {
border:1px solid #999;
border-bottom:none;
background:#fff;
height:25px;
line-height:26px;
margin:0
}
.content { padding:10px}
</style>
<body>
<p class="box">
<p class="tagMenu">
<ul class="menu">
<li>Label 1.1</li>
<li>Label 1.2</li>
<li>Label 1.3</li>
<li>Label 1.4</li>
</ul>
</p>
<p class="content">
<p class="layout">infomation 1.1</p>
<p class="layout">infomation 1.2</p>
<p class="layout">infomation 1.3</p>
<p class="layout">infomation 1.4</p>
</p>
</p>
</body>
</html>

代码如下:

<html>
<title>
</title>
<script src="js/jquery.min.js" type="text/javascript"></script>
<script language="javascript" type="text/javascript">
$(document).ready(function(){
$("ul.menu li:first-child").addClass("current");
$("p.content").find("p.layout:not(:first-child)").hide();
$("p.content p.layout").attr("id", function(){return idNumber("No")+ $("p.content p.layout").index(this)});
$("ul.menu li").click(function(){
var c = $("ul.menu li");
var index = c.index(this);
var p = idNumber("No");
show(c,index,p);
});

function show(controlMenu,num,prefix){
var content= prefix + num;
$('#'+content).siblings().hide();
$('#'+content).show();
controlMenu.eq(num).addClass("current").siblings().removeClass("current");
};

function idNumber(prefix){
var idNum = prefix;
return idNum;
};
});
</script>
<style type="text/css">
* {margin:0; padding:0}
ul,li {
list-style:none
}
.box {
border:1px solid #ccc;
margin:10px;
}
.tagMenu {
height: 24px;
position:relative;
border-bottom:1px solid #999
}
.tagMenu ul {
position:absolute;
bottom:-1px;
height:26px;
}
ul.menu li {
float:left;
border-left:1px solid #999;
padding:0 12px;
cursor:pointer
}
ul.menu li.current {
border:1px solid #999;
border-bottom:none;
background:#fff;
height:25px;
line-height:26px;
margin:0
}
.content { padding:10px}
</style>
<body>
<p class="box">
<p class="tagMenu">
<ul class="menu">
<li>Label 1.1</li>
<li>Label 1.2</li>
<li>Label 1.3</li>
<li>Label 1.4</li>
</ul>
</p>
<p class="content">
<p class="layout">infomation 1.1</p>
<p class="layout">infomation 1.2</p>
<p class="layout">infomation 1.3</p>
<p class="layout">infomation 1.4</p>
</p>
</p>
</body>
</html>

觉得可用,就经常来吧!Javascript技巧 脚本宝典 欢迎评论哦! js技巧,巧夺天工,精雕玉琢。小宝典献丑了!

总结

以上是脚本宝典为你收集整理的

js实例教程-基于jquery库的tab新形式使用方法

全部内容,希望文章能够帮你解决

js实例教程-基于jquery库的tab新形式使用方法

所遇到的程序开发问题,欢迎加入QQ群277859234一起讨论学习。如果觉得脚本宝典网站内容还不错,欢迎将脚本宝典网站推荐给程序员好友。 本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。

80%的人都看过